Barn rules were designed to keep riders and their horses safe and happy. It can be hard to share a facility with others. After all, everyone has a certain way they like to do things. Rules help the entire barn get on the same page. Everyone will know what is expected of them!
Barn Rules
- If you open a gate, then make sure to close it up afterwards. Double check it before you leave!
- Turn off the barn lights when you’re done.
- Sweep up the grooming or cross-tie area afterwards.
- If your horse poops in the riding arena, then scoop it up!
- Don’t borrow other boarder’s tack without asking.
- If you move things in the arena, then put them back when you’re done.
- Don’t feed other people’s horses without their permission.
- Kids must be watched at all times. They shouldn’t scream, run, or cry around the horses.
- No smoking in the barn or on the property.
- If you break anything, be prepared to fix it or replace it.
